TEL. 053-453-6585
OPEN&CLOSE.  9:00~19:00
CLODED SHOP.  MONDAY
 
 
 

copyfile 예제

2019年8月2日

소스가 문자열인 경우 괄호 안에 있는 모든 입력을 동봉합니다. 예를 들어, 이동 파일(“myfile.m”,”newfolder”). 예를 들어, 사용자의 문서 폴더에 파일을 복사하려면 기존 파일에 대한 파일 속성이 새 파일에 복사됩니다. 예를 들어 기존 파일에 FILE_ATTRIBUTE_READONLY 파일 특성이 있는 경우 CopyFile 호출을 통해 만든 복사본에도 FILE_ATTRIBUTE_READONLY 파일 특성이 있습니다. 자세한 내용은 파일 특성 검색 및 변경을 참조하십시오. 복사 명령에서 여러 파일 이름을 지정할 수 없습니다. 그러나 와일드카드를 사용하여 파일 그룹을 식별한 다음 모든 파일을 단일 명령으로 복사할 수 있습니다. 예를 들어 현재 폴더의 모든 Excel 파일을 다른 폴더 F:backup으로 복사하려면 이 예제에서는 현재 디렉터리의 myfiles 디렉터리의 모든 파일과 하위 디렉토리가 디렉터리 d:/work/myfiles에 복사됩니다. 카피 파일 함수를 실행하기 전에 d:/work에는 디렉터리 myfiles가 포함되지 않습니다. myfiles는 copyfile 함수의 대상에 추가되기 때문에 만들어집니다: ignore 인수를 사용하여 로깅 호출을 추가하는 또 다른 예: 와일드카드 문자는 소스 인수의 마지막 경로 구성 요소에서만 사용할 수 있습니다. 예를 들어 사용할 수 있습니다: 이 예제에서는 사용자의 .ssh 디렉터리에 있는 모든 파일을 포함하는 gzip`ed tar-file 아카이브를 만듭니다.

이 모듈에서 제공하는 많은 다른 함수를 보여 줍니다. 이 팩터리 함수는 copytree()의 무시 인수에 대해 호출 가능한 함수로 사용할 수 있는 함수를 만들고 제공된 glob 스타일 패턴 중 하나와 일치하는 파일 및 디렉터리를 무시합니다. 아래 예제를 참조하십시오. 복사 명령의 구문 및 사용 사례는 예제와 함께 아래에 설명되어 있습니다. 이에 대한 소스 코드는 궁극적인 도구가 아닌 예제로 간주되어야 합니다. ignore_patterns() 도우미를 사용하는 또 다른 예: Windows “복사”는 재미있습니다. “복사 1 2″를 입력하고 파일 “1”은 새 파일 “2”로 복사됩니다. 이제 공백 대신 플러스 기호로 구분하면 (1 +2 복사) 1과 2를 연결하고 이전 파일 “1”을 연결의 결과로 바꿉니다! 대상 파일이 이미 있고 기호 링크인 경우 기호 링크의 대상이 원본 파일로 덮어씁입니다. cd, 삭제, 디르, 파일러트리브, 파일 브라우저, 파일 파트, mkdir, 무브파일, rmdir CopyFileEx 함수는 두 가지 추가 기능을 제공합니다.

CopyFileEx는 복사 작업의 일부가 완료될 때마다 지정된 콜백 함수를 호출할 수 있으며 복사 작업 중에 CopyFileEx를 취소할 수 있습니다. 경로 문자열의 * 와일드카드가 지원됩니다. 와일드카드 *를 사용하거나 디렉터리를 복사할 때 유닉스와 Windows간에 카피파일의 현재 동작이 다릅니다. myfun.m을 디렉토리 d:/work/myfiles에 복사하려면 동일한 파일 이름을 유지하면서 파일 src를 파일 또는 디렉터리 dst에 복사합니다. dst가 디렉터리인 경우 src와 동일한 기본 이름을 가진 파일이 지정된 디렉토리에 생성(또는 덮어쓰임)됩니다.

コメント